A security vulnerability was identified in JetBrains TeamCity versions prior to 2023.11.4, where presigned URL generation requests in the S3 Artifact Storage plugin were not properly authorized. The vulnerability was assigned CVE-2024-28174 and was reported by the Rapid7 team (NVD, JetBrains Advisory).
The vulnerability is classified as CWE-863 (Incorrect Authorization) and received a CVSS v3.1 base score of 5.8 (Medium), with the vector string C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:C/C:N/I:L/A:N. This indicates that the vulnerability is network-accessible, requires low attack complexity, needs no privileges or user interaction, and can potentially impact system integrity (NVD).
The vulnerability could allow unauthorized access to presigned URL generation requests in the S3 Artifact Storage plugin, potentially compromising the integrity of artifact storage operations (NVD).
The vulnerability is remotely exploitable with no authentication required, as indicated by the CVSS metrics showing network accessibility (AV:N) and no privileges required (PR:N) (NVD).
Users are advised to upgrade to TeamCity version 2023.11.4 or later to address this vulnerability (JetBrains Advisory).
